Climate Change SG brings you news and insights on climate science, impacts and actions from Singapore

Climate Change SG is set up by the National Climate Change Secretariat (NCCS), Strategy Group, Prime Minister’s Office. If you are interested to learn about Singapore’s climate change strategy, go to http://www.nccs.gov.sg/resources/publications to download our Climate Action Plan, which provides updates on our nation’s strategy to reduce greenhouse gas emissions and adapt to the effects of climate change. To find out more about NCCS and the work we do, visit www.nccs.gov.sg.

It’s hard to imagine Singapore getting hotter than it already is, but it could come true in the coming years. Climate change is causing average global temperatures to increase gradually, which affects the environment – and us – in multiple ways.

Let us collectively make a difference by adopting habits such as reducing energy use and making more environmentally friendly choices.

Singapore may be small, but our steps towards a low-carbon future are anything but! By working with international partners on carbon markets, scaling up renewable energy and building a climate-resilient future, Singapore is playing its part to tackle climate change!
